首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Google模板\ Python \ LImitations

Google模板\ Python \ LImitations
EN

Stack Overflow用户
提问于 2020-08-19 10:29:34
回答 1查看 293关注 0票数 0

请社区总结Python在Google DataFlow模板上的局限性

  1. Python对源代码有限制:我们没有可以接受运行时参数的BigQuery、BigTable和Pubsub源的连接器
  2. 我们支持运行时参数,但它只支持简单的参数替换。
  3. 不支持NestedValueProvider (它允许我们计算来自另一个ValueProvider对象的值)。

如果我错了,请纠正我。如果我漏掉了什么就告诉我。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2020-08-19 23:34:10

根据文档,BigQuery读取连接器支持ValueProvider对象,因此应该可以在BigQuery源上使用运行时参数。

BigTable连接器还没有提供读取/源代码支持,目前只能使用BigTable作为写入输出;但是,ValueProvider参数还不支持。

Pub/Sub连接器支持源和接收器,只支持流管道。与BigTable连接器一样,ValueProvider参数尚未得到支持。

关于NestedValueProvider,是的,正如数据流模板文档中提到的,Apache不支持NestedValueProvider。

您可以始终检查Apache波束释放说明以随时更新最新特性,或者跟踪Jira上的相关特性请求,例如,已经有了一个打开对DynamicDestinations实现的BigtableIO请求,尽管它是用于Java的。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/63485022

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档